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ML) startup Dataiku recently announced to have $400M in Series E investment. Tiger Global led the round, and several existing investors, including ICONIQ Growth, FirstMark Capital, Battery Ventures, CapitalG, Snowflake Ventures, and Dawn Capital, also participated in the round. Further, Insight Partners, Eurazeo, Lightrock, and Datadog CEO Olivier Pomel also took part.
With this capital, the startup’s total valuation now has come to $4.6B, and this will also help Dataiku systemize the use of data for better results.
Founded in 2013 by Florian Douetteau, Clément Stenac, Thomas Cabrol and Marc Batty, the company helps data scientists and data engineers design, deploy and manage AI and analytical applications. It has worked with 450 companies so far.
At the time of the latest funding round, Dataiku’s team consists of 750 people in offices in New York, Paris, London, Munich, Sydney, and Singapore.
